What is DJI Dock 3?
DJI Dock 3 is an advanced automated drone docking station designed for enterprise operations. It allows drones to launch, land, recharge, and operate remotely without requiring on-site pilots for every mission. The system supports fully automated workflows, making it ideal for industries where repetitive inspections and continuous monitoring are necessary.
The dock is engineered to withstand harsh weather conditions and supports remote drone deployment for critical operations. Businesses can schedule flights, monitor missions in real-time, and receive high-quality aerial data through cloud-connected management systems.

Factors That Affect DJI Dock 3 Price
1. Drone Type
Different drones offer different capabilities. High-end drones equipped with thermal cameras, LiDAR sensors, or advanced zoom lenses can increase the total dji dock 3 price package.
Surveying teams may require mapping-focused drones, while security teams may prioritize thermal imaging and night operations.
2. Camera and Sensor Payloads
Industrial drone applications often require specialized payloads such as:
- Thermal imaging cameras
- LiDAR scanners
- High-resolution mapping cameras
- Multispectral sensors
- Zoom inspection cameras
The more advanced the payload, the higher the overall system cost.
3. Software and Cloud Services
Most enterprise drone dock systems rely on cloud-based software platforms for:
- Mission scheduling
- Flight monitoring
- Data storage
- AI analytics
- Reporting dashboards
Software subscriptions can influence the final dji dock 3 price depending on user requirements and deployment size.
4. Installation and Infrastructure
Some installations require additional infrastructure such as:
- Internet connectivity
- Power backup systems
- Mounting structures
- Weather protection
- Security integration
Large industrial sites may require multiple dock installations, increasing deployment costs.
5. Support and Maintenance
Businesses investing in autonomous drone systems typically require:
- Technical support
- Maintenance contracts
- Firmware updates
- Operator training
- Spare parts availability
Reliable support is essential for mission-critical operations.
